模糊神经网络非线性组合预测在铁路货运量预测中的应用
Application of Nonlinear Combination Forecast of Fuzzy Neural Networkon Forecasting Railway Freight Volume
【摘要】 准确的铁路货运量预测关系到铁路运输的发展,为此提出模糊神经网络非线性组合预测模型,应用三次指数预测模型、灰色理论预测模型、多元回归预测模型的预测值作为模糊神经网络的测试样本数据库,输出样本为铁路货运量,并采用全局优化的粒子群算法优化模糊神经网络的参数。仿真结果表明该模型能够取得比单项预测模型更高的精度。
【Abstract】 Accurate forecasting for railway freight volumeis important to the development of railway transportation.This paper presents nonlinear combination forecast modelof fuzzy neural network,uses the results of three-timeexponential forecast model,grey theory forecast modeland multiple regression forecast model as the test sampledatabase of fuzzy neural network,thereinto the outputsample is the railway freight volume,and also uses thewhole optimized particle swarm algorithm to optimize theparameters of fuzzy neural network.The simulation resultsdemonstrate the proposed model can improve theaccuracy compared with individual forecasting model.
